At the beginning of July this year, Chery introduced the successor to Chery Tiggo 7 Pro, which was named Chery Tiggo 7 Plus. The car received an updated radiator grill, a modified bumper and T-shaped daytime running lights.
Now there are high-quality photos of the interior and details about the car. Despite the prefix Plus in the name, the car did not receive a third seat or an increased wheelbase, the dimensions did not change either. The main feature of Chery Tiggo 7 Plus is the updated interior design. The new car received a large panel with two 12.3-inch screens instead of a separate display for the multimedia system and digital instrument cluster.

The new Lion 4.0 media system supports voice control and enhanced online capabilities. The center console and tunnel have also been redesigned, and the new climate control knobs will delight those who don’t like the touch buttons. If you look from the outside, in addition to the changes listed in the first paragraph, the car also received fake air ducts on the front fenders and 19-inch wheels.
The car is equipped with the same 147 hp 1.5-liter engine, which is now complemented by a 48-volt starter-generator. This lightweight hybrid system, equipped with a CVT, boosts the crossover’s power to around 170bhp. There is also a 197-horsepower 1.6-liter version with a robot. According to Chery, the 1.6-liter version accelerates from 0 to 100 km / h in 8.28 seconds and has a consumption of 6.6 liters per 100 km.




In China, Chery Tiggo 7 Plus will be sold in parallel with Chery Tiggo 7 Pro, sales will start in the fall. The price will be higher, but it is not yet known how much. It should be noted that Chery Tiggo 7 Pro is very popular in Russia and other CIS countries.
